For years, nonprofits, politicians, state agencies and the U.S. Forest Service have pointed to the East Fork of the upper San Gabriel River as one of the more polluted fresh water rivers in the state. In 2013, the Los Angeles-Area Regional Water Quality Control Board rated this 2.5-mile stretch of the East Fork an F for violating the agencys standards for trash. The program came about as a result of President Barack Obamas 2014 designation of 342,175 acres of the forest as a national monument. Changing water levels, unseen rocks, and river bottoms that have shifted with currents and seasonal weather can turn a well-known jumping area into a serious hazard. For the last three years, teams of young, often bilingual rangers would roam the picnic areas in the East Fork, explaining how trash damages the water supply.
